PT - Physical Therapist

Job Details:

* Day shift, 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M
* Full-time position
* Provide physical therapy services to referred patients including assessment, treatment plan development, implementation, follow-up, and discharge planning
* Perform comprehensive diagnostic evaluations to determine physical and cognitive abilities of inpatients and outpatients based on diagnosis and age-specific needs
* Develop and implement individualized treatment plans with patient and family participation, including measurable goals and methods to achieve goals
* Adhere to documentation policies and procedures including initial patient evaluations, daily and weekly progress notes, discharge summaries, and other appropriate notations
* Participate in patient care conferences, family conferences, in-service programs, and departmental and interdepartmental meetings
* Counsel patients, families, and other involved individuals regarding patient evaluation, care, and treatment
* Initiate and complete discharge planning in a timely manner and provide effective education and training
* Assist with coordination and supervision of Physical Therapy and Physical Therapy Assistant student programs as well as the volunteer program
* Assist with clinical aspects of the department including orientation of new associates and scheduling of patients
* Support and participate in Performance Improvement activities
* Maintain awareness of community agencies and resources to make appropriate referrals when indicated
* Supervise Licensed Physical Therapy Assistants, Rehab Technicians, and Volunteers
* Bachelor's, Master's, or entry-level Doctorate of Physical Therapy degree from an accredited college or university required
* Current New Mexico Physical Therapist Licensure required
* BLS certification via AHA required
* Proficiency with all modalities and equipment used by a Physical Therapist as outlined by the Executive Council of Physical Therapy and Occupational Therapy Examiners
